RADIO WOKING BREAKFAST
WEDNESDAY 1ST AUGUST 2018
The second part of my visit to the Light House in Woking. I spoke to more of the team who run things at the food bank and the Light House. I was also able to talk to Michael who is a user of the food bank after falling on hard times. His story is a tale of bravery and courage and shows there is light at the end of the tunnel when you are facing your darkest hour.
